| Files in this directory are data for Go's API checker ("go tool api", in src/cmd/api). |
| |
| Each file is a list of API features, one per line. |
| |
| go1.txt (and similarly named files) are frozen once a version has been |
| shipped. Each file adds new lines but does not remove any. |
| |
| except.txt lists features that may disappear without breaking true |
| compatibility. |
| |
| next.txt is the only file intended to be mutated. It's a list of |
| features that may be added to the next version. It only affects |
| warning output from the go api tool. |
| |
| fuchsia.txt lists Fuchsia specific features. After a full build, this |
| list can be regenerated with |
| |
| $(fx get-build-dir)/host-tools/goroot/bin/go tool api | grep -e '^pkg syscall/zx' > ${FUCHSIA_DIR}/third_party/go/api/fuchsia.txt |